Stat. § 59:2-7","heading":"Recreational facilities","body":"A public entity is not liable for failure to provide supervision of public recreational facilities;  provided, however, that nothing in this section shall  exonerate a public entity from liability for failure to protect against a  dangerous condition as provided in chapter 4.\nL.1972, c. 45, s. 59:2-7.","path":["TITLE 59 CLAIMS AGAINST PUBLIC ENTITIES"],"source_url":"https://pub.njleg.state.nj.us/statutes/STATUTES-TEXT.zip","current_through":"P.L.2025, c.405, and J.R.22","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T17:54:13Z","sha256":"cd9c5fc4f40db2bec03326cc0ddca983ba53419e3f3e78e4e555950f5cdc3412","source_id":"us-nj","stale":true,"prev":"us-nj/n.j.-stat.-59-2-6","next":"us-nj/n.j.-stat.-59-2-8"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
